Programmatic Video Generation API
The cornerstone of Renderly is its RESTful API, designed for high-volume, automated video creation. Developers can send a POST request with a JSON payload containing template references and dynamic variables to instantly trigger a render. The API provides endpoints for checking job status, managing render queues, and retrieving finished videos, complete with webhook support for asynchronous workflows. This feature turns video production into a programmable utility, seamlessly integrable into any software stack for automated, data-driven content pipelines.
Template-Driven JSON Configuration
Renderly utilizes a powerful template system where videos are defined and controlled through JSON configuration files. Users create a master template in the online editor, specifying scenes, layers (text, images, video clips), animations, and timing. Dynamic elements are marked as variables. To generate personalized videos, the API simply swaps these variables with values from an incoming JSON object. This approach offers immense flexibility, version control capabilities, and the ability to manage complex video designs as code, enabling consistent branding and rapid iteration.

How does the API integration work?
Integration is straightforward. First, you design a template using Renderly's online editor or by defining a JSON structure. This template includes placeholder variables. Then, you use Renderly's SDKs or direct REST API calls from your application. You send a POST request to the /render endpoint with your template ID and a JSON object containing the values for your variables. The API returns a job ID, and you can poll the /status endpoint or use webhooks to retrieve the final video URL upon completion.

How does the credit-based pricing model calculate costs?
You purchase credits, and each credit corresponds to a second of rendered video output (at standard definition). The cost per credit decreases with higher volume purchases. You are only charged for the final duration of each video you generate. The platform provides a cost calculator tool to help estimate expenses, and billing is transparent, with detailed usage reports to track consumption.
